    Must the surface pro have to be open or can it be remained close to have more desk space?

    • @Kperryglobal
      @Kperryglobal  2 года назад +1

      You can use the Surface while its close. You must change the power option setting. Go to Start window, type Control Panel, Power Options, then select Change what closing the lid does.

    Is it possible to connect three external montors to The Surface 7? I have a Surface 4 and I am able to but not able to replicate on SP7. Please advise

    • @Kperryglobal
      @Kperryglobal  2 года назад +1

      Thank you for your question. You can only extend your Surface display using the Surface dock to 2 external monitors. Connecting the 3rd monitor directly to the Surface device using an adapter will not work simultaneously because the Surface device processor can only support two monitors at a time. You can only use the 3rd monitor if you are to daisy chain it to another monitor that is connected to the dock, but daisy chaining is just simply letting you replicate the display of the monitor where it is connected to.
